Summary

CVE-2023-44217 is a local privilege escalation vulnerability found in SonicWall Net Extender MSI client for Windows 10.2.336 and earlier versions. This vulnerability allows a local low-privileged user to gain system privileges by running the repair functionality. The potential danger of this vulnerability is rated as high with a base severity score of 7.8 out of 10. It has a low privileges-required level and does not require user interaction. The attack vector is local and it can have a significant impact on the integrity and confidentiality of the affected systems. To remediate this vulnerability, it is recommended to update SonicWall Net Extender MSI client to a version beyond 10.2.336.
